## Shipping a FeedCheckly plugin

Hey plugin folks! Before you push a new validator module for FeedCheckly, run the lint pass against the sample feeds in the `fixtures/` folder — especially the weird enclosure edge cases. If your plugin touches episode GUID parsing, bump the minor version, not the patch. Once the build is green, package it with `fcpack bundle` and sign the archive. Use the key below to sign your release bundle.

signing key of bagap-yawep = bky13_TbfT6ZMUoGJo2

## Tuning: Date Localization

Quickdate resolves locale formats at render time. Caching the resolved pattern per locale cut p95 latency by 40% in the Varnholt cluster. Don't hardcode separators; the Lunaro spec forbids it. Fallback is always ISO-8601 when locale detection fails. Refresh intervals and cache sizes were re-tuned after last week's regression. Current constants are as follows.

tuning table, yajog-yahof:
BUDGETS = {
    "lamvan": 303,
    "wenox": 460,
    "fenvan": 525,
}

### Step 4: Migrate the clue dictionary

Gridforge's crossword generator previously stored clue-answer pairs in flat YAML under `data/clues/`. This step moves them into the new `lexicon` schema so the fill engine can query by length and letter pattern. Run `gridforge migrate lexicon --dry-run` first and verify the row count matches the YAML entry count exactly; any mismatch indicates encoding issues in older files. Once verified, run the migration for real against the target database using the connection string below.

primary connection of yagep-kahip = redis://giliel_svc:zYiKsLL2PLpfPL@db-348f.xolmarsys.corp:5432/fenwyn

Minutes — Management Meeting, Orvano Systems

Attendees: R. Halvesen, T. Mireau, J. Okendal.

The group reviewed the warranty-cost overrun on the Calyx router line, now 27% above budget. Main drivers: early firmware faults and elevated return rates in the Bremholt region. Finance will restate the accrual and present revised figures next week. Operations committed to a corrective-action plan within ten days. Management agreed the overrun affects near-term planning, as outlined in the confidential note below.

board note of taweg-fahof: Eliiusax Group plans to raise the Ralwyn list price by 60 percent in August.